JIŘÍ BRDEČKA X 2
Classics
See nine of Brdečka’s beautifully animated shorts in this program that includes Gallina Vogelbirdae (1963), a work that won the Grand Prix at the Annecy International Animation Festival, bringing him great acclaim in the West. (program approx. 100 mins., DCP)
Program organized by Limonádový Joe s.r.o. in partnership with Czech Centres, produced by Comeback Company. Films courtesy of the Czech National Film Archive, Krátký Film Praha a.s., and Rembrandt Films.
Tonight’s program:
The Springer and the SS-Men (Pérák a SS, 1946, 14 mins.)
Reason and Emotion (Rozum a cit, 1962, 15 mins.)
The Frozen Logger (Zmrzlý dřevař, 1962, 5 mins.)
Gallina Vogelbirdae (Špatně namalovaná slepice, 1963, 14 mins.)
The Letter M (Slóvce M, 1964, 9 mins.)
Forrester’s Song (Do lesíčka na čekanou, 1966, 10 mins.)
Metamorpheus (Metamorfeus, 1969, 13 mins.)
There Was a Miller on a River (Jsouc na řece mlynář jeden, 1971 ,11 mins.)
Prince Copperslick (Třináctá komnata prince Měděnce, 1980, 9 mins.)
